#include <iostream>
using namespace std;
int main(){
int q;
cin>>q;
long long l[q],r[q];
for(int i=1;i<=q;i++){
cin>>l[i]>>r[i];
}
for(int i=1;i<=q;i++){
int sum=0;
long long j=l[i];
while(j<=r[i]){
long long h=j;
bool flag=false;
while(h>0){
int kk=h%10;
if(kk1){
flag=true;
}
h/=10;
}
if(j%30&&flag==true){
sum++;
}
j++;
}
cout<<sum<<endl;
}
return 0;
}